Abstract

A hybrid cotton seed production labeling method relates to the technical field of hybrid cotton seed production. The technical scheme is as follows: after pollination during hybrid cotton seed production is finished, the flower stalk of a pollinated flower is pinched by a left hand at first, and then two sepals are torn off from the root transversely by a right hand, wherein lissom movements are required. The hybrid cotton seed production labeling method can perform labeling without tying lines, installing rings or printing ink, and is low in cost and high in accuracy.

Background technology
The cotton hybrid production of hybrid seeds, in order to improve seed production purity, prevent mixed adopt or people for mixing, the method made marks after generally all adopting pollination, like this in whole production of hybrid seeds process, the seed production purity that can effectively control to cause because of artificial or other factors is inadequate, thus bring loss to seeding farmer and manufacturer, therefore the method for hybrid seeding mark is adopted, the general cotton hybrid production of hybrid seeds labeling method just adopted of current world-class company is bolt line or band, or adopt and be coated with stamp-pad ink, mark obviously, but also there is certain defect in this kind of method, mainly following point:
1, cost of labor is high, adopts bolt line or band, or is coated with stamp-pad ink, add cost of labor undoubtedly, according to every mu of average 100 works calculation of the cotton hybrid production of hybrid seeds at present, Gansu cost of labor every day average price is 150 yuan of every days, accumulative cost of labor is 15000 yuan, and cost of labor is higher.
2, production cost improves, and is no matter the general nylon wire that just uses or plastic hoop now, and by every only 0.03 yuan, every strain is pollinated 20 flowers, and every mu of 4000 strains, cost is about 2400 yuan, and cost is higher.
3, accuracy rate is marked large by man's activity, by bolt line or band, in practical operation, by artificial limbs by touching, or in the ripe picking process of cotton, all likely there will be and come off, and be coated with stamp-pad ink, sprayed insecticide by field, or raining all to make mark slowly come off, truly cannot judge whether pollination, affect the accuracy rate of the production of hybrid seeds, remote-effects seed purity.

Embodiment
A kind of cotton hybrid production of hybrid seeds labeling method, its embodiment and principle as follows:
Sepal removes the principle of labeling method: the technical scheme understanding sepal removal method, first structure and the effect of cotton sepal will be learnt about, the sepal of cotton mainly contains 5-7 sheet oval shape, parcel petal, there is a small amount of thorn and villous covering, sepal and petal the flowers are in blossom put before there is the function protecting flower interior, containing number of chemical material inside sepal, such as flavones ingredient, fluorescence special as seen under the specific wavelengths such as ultraviolet light, this fluorescence can attract and guide corresponding insect to come to suck Hua Mi, thus auxiliary propagation pollen, the sepal of cotton removes non-artificial removal and has permanent existence, this is also that we adopt the cardinal principle of sepal removal method, no matter from the formation of flower until the harvesting of the maturation of cotton, sepal all can forever exist in whole growth and development process, and there is uniqueness.
Sepal removes the method for operating of labeling method: we are generally in cotton hybrid seed production and pollination process, choose the flower emasculation that can open for second day, the next morning, the flowers are in blossom put after pollinate, pollination terminates, just need to have made marks, first the anthocaulus pinching pollination flower with left hand is needed, laterally two pieces of sepals are removed with the right hand, quick and graceful in the movements, need to be grasped dynamics, this method it is to be noted that first, must laterally remove, can not be longitudinal because may damage whole flower; The second, can not nip off sepal, because sepal also can be able to increase along with expanding of cotton, the sepal nipped off also can increase, for the judgement in later stage brings difficulty; Three, need to remove two pieces of sepals, if only remove one piece, along with expanding of cotton, unfolding of sepal, can cause mark between sepal not obvious, impact judge, tear sepal except increasing workload and increasing except flower wound more, more do not act on, so it is best to remove two pieces of sepals.
